If an NmtEditorGrid row has a widget, but no label, then we make the
widget span both the label and widget columns. But previously we
weren't doing the same for rows with labels but no widgets. (In fact,
we didn't even allow rows with no widgets; label-only rows had to
specify dummy widgets.)
Fix it so that labels will span into an empty widget column. (This
ensures that a long section name won't force the entire grid to have
an overwide label column).
Also, in both the "no label" and "no widget" cases, still show the
"extra" column if it's present.

Instead of having NmtEditorPage be a widget itself, have it just be an
object that returns a list of NmtEditorSections, where
NmtEditorSection is a subclass of NmtNewtSection.
(This will be important when adding VPN pages, which will be split up
into multiple sections, but with the different sections needing to
cooperate on updating the NMSettingVpn. This reorganization lets us
have an NMPageVpn containing multiple sections, with the NMPageVpn
object handling the coordination between the sections.)

Since adding NMSettingIPConfig:gateway, we were just binding that
property to the Gateway entry as a string. But this caused two
different problems: first, we were trying to set the :gateway property
from the entry even when the IP address in the entry was incomplete
(causing warnings), and second, we were no longer enforcing the rule
that the gateway can only be set when there are static addresses
configured.
Fix this by adding back nm_editor_bind_ip_gateway_to_string(), but
with new semantics reflecting the new way NMSettingIPConfig:addresses
and :gateway work. (Besides just fixing the new bugs, this also makes
the Gateway entry insensitive when there are no addresses; before,
nmtui would allow you to type there, but the value would not be
saved.)

The gateway is a global property of the IPv4/IPv6 configuration, not
an attribute of any particular address. So represent it as such in the
API; remove the gateway from NMIPAddress, and add it to
NMSettingIPConfig.
Behind the scenes, the gateway is still serialized along with the
first address in NMSettingIPConfig:addresses, and is deserialized from
that if the settings dictionary doesn't contain a 'gateway' key.
Adjust nmcli's interactive mode to prompt for IP addresses and gateway
separately. (Patch partly from Jirka Klimeš.)

Move the definition of NMSecretAgentError to nm-errors, register it
with D-Bus, and verify in the tests that it maps correctly.
NM_SECRET_AGENT_ERROR_INTERNAL_ERROR is renamed to
NM_SECRET_AGENT_ERROR_FAILED, and NM_SECRET_AGENT_ERROR_NOT_AUTHORIZED
to NM_SECRET_AGENT_ERROR_PERMISSION_DENIED, for consistency with other
error domains. While NMSecretAgentError, unlike most other error
domains, has always been correctly mapped across D-Bus, the renaming
is not an ABI break, because the daemon never checks for either of
those values, so all versions of the daemon will treat
"org.freedesktop.NetworkManager.SecretAgent.InternalError" and
"org.freedesktop.NetworkManager.SecretAgent.Failed" the same (by just
ignoring the error name and keeping only the error message).

NMActiveConnection:connection was an object path rather than an
NMRemoteConnection because in the past the NMObject property system
wasn't capable of handling NMRemoteConnection-valued properties.
NMActiveConnection:master was an object path rather than an NMDevice
entirely by accident. Fix both.
NMActiveConnection:specific-object can't currently be converted to an
object, because we don't know ahead of time what object type it is,
and NMObject can't deal with that. Instead, we rename it to
:specific-object-path (and likewise for its get function), both to
emphasize that it doesn't behave like other properties, and to leave
the old name open for an actual object-valued property later on.

nmt_newt_grid_size_allocate() depends on nmt_newt_grid_size_request()
having been called immediately prior, which would normally be true,
except that NmtNewtSection adjusts the label widgets in its border to
match its allocation, so when its size changes, it will end up calling
size_allocate() on the border with out-of-date requisition data. Fix
that by re-size_requesting the border after modifying it.
